
Niki French showed us what's left of her daughter's trampoline. Someone stole the trampoline out of their backyard late last week.
"We're very upset that someone would come into our yard and steal something we worked hard for," says French.
The trampoline was a vital part of her disabled daughter's physical therapy program. Nine year old Brianna had open heart surgery when she was younger and suffered a stroke during the procedure. That incident left her disabled and in desperate need of physical activity.
"Brianna is basically non verbal due to the stroke, but she was very upset. She still walks out in the backyard looking for it and we have no explanation as to who took it and why they took it," says French. "The police think it was probably some teenagers, they were going to talk to some troubled teens in the area."
The French's have a message for whoever stole the trampoline...
"I hope you can find it in your heart to bring it back to us, my husband and I scraped and pinched and saved every bit of money to be able to buy it, I won't press charges, we just want it back."
Late Monday afternoon, a News 5 viewer contacted me and offered to donate a trampoline to the French family. We'll keep you posted on what happens.
